
python中如何导入随机数
用户关注问题
Python中如何生成随机整数?
在Python中,我想生成一个指定范围内的随机整数,该怎么做?
使用random模块生成随机整数
可以通过导入Python的random模块,使用random.randint(a, b)函数来生成范围[a, b]内的随机整数。例如:
import random
num = random.randint(1, 10)
如何在Python中生成随机浮点数?
除了整数,Python能否生成浮点类型的随机数?如果可以,应该如何操作?
利用random模块生成随机浮点数
random模块提供random.random()函数,可以生成0到1之间的随机浮点数。也可以使用random.uniform(a, b)来生成指定范围a到b之间的随机浮点数。
例如:
import random
num = random.uniform(5.5, 9.5)
导入random模块有什么注意事项?
在Python代码中使用随机数功能时,导入random模块需要关注哪些细节,避免出现问题?
导入random模块的常见注意点
确保在使用随机数相关函数之前先导入random模块。常见导入方式是使用import random。此外,不要将变量命名为random,以免覆盖模块名称导致调用失败。保持模块导入和调用的一致性可以避免出错。